
Golden Nugget Ride - old Las Vegas
New year - new luck; that could have been the story around this ride together with our sales manager Brian in the surroundings of Las Vegas.
After one year of leading the B2B for US together with the team based in San Clemente in SoCal, we attended AIMExpo, a B2B motorcycle show in Las Vegas. After a gas consuming drive with the company truck pulling our promotion trailer and watching the Superbowl 2023 at the House of Blues in Mandaly bay Hotel, we had time for a ride.
So said we choosed a loop east of Las Vegas touching the Lake Las Vegas. Starting from our Hotel, the Paris, we took some streets providing a combined bus and bike lane leaving the city. Reaching Henderson City was also kind of the boarder to enter the dessert. Luckily already there we did not have a lot of traffic. This became even better when we entered the National Park connected to Lake Mead, built by the famous Hoover Dam.
The weather luckily was warm and sunny so we could ride short/short which would have been different the following days as we even had snow there. Our goal was to go around Frenchman Mountain and head back into the city entering a little more north. We were almost alone and could enjoy the ride including a faboulos landscape.
Saying fabulous brings us to the fun part of the ride hitting Old Las Vegas and Freemont Street with its famous Neon Cowboy Sign. The Freemont Casino, the Golden Nugget and the incredible Screen Installation with its awesome videos - all iconic attractions which we could include to our ride.
The last part was the maybe most tricky: riding back to our hotel on the Las Vegas Strip. But also this turned out to be an easy one and so we finished our tour befitting at the Arc de Triomphe. One last game with our bikes next to us to finanze our evening program...
